Шаблон:Listing: различия между версиями

Содержимое удалено Содержимое добавлено
+значок Викиданных при наличии параметра wdid
maplink call + minor style fixes
Строка 10:
--><span id="{{anchorencode:{{{name}}}}}"><!--
 
Map symbolmarker
-----><b>{{#if:{{{lat|}}}|{{#if:{{{long|}}}<!--
-->|{{marker|lat={{{lat|}}}|long={{{long|}}}|name={{{name|}}}|type={{{type|}}}|image={{{image|}}}|zoom={{{zoom|}}}}}<!--
 
Map marker with a link to the map
----->|<span class="plainlinks">[{{PoiMap2|{{{lat|0}}}|{{{long|0}}}|15|M}}<span class="listing-map{{#ifeq:{{{type|listing}}}|other|&#32;listing-general}}{{#ifeq:{{{type|listing}}}|go|&#32;listing-general}}" style="background:{{TypeToColor|{{{type|other}}}}}" title="Открыть карту">&nbsp;</span>]</span><!--
----->|}}|<!--
 
Empty colored square for listings without coordinates, format=nocoords will suppress this completely
----->|}}|<!--
----><span style="background:{{TypeToColor|{{{type|other}}}}}; color:{{#ifeq:{{{format|}}}|nocoords|white|{{TypeToColor|{{{type|listing}}}}}}}; padding:{{#ifeq:{{{format|}}}|nocoords|0pt 0.25em|0pt 0.1em 0pt 0.35em}}; font-size: 0.8em">{{#ifeq:{{{format|}}}|nocoords|✦|12}}</span>}}</b><!--
-->{{#switch: {{{format|}}}|poi=|star=&thinsp;&#9734;&thinsp;|&thinsp;&thinsp;}}<!--
-->}}<!--
 
Name
-->{{#switch: {{{format|}}}|poi=|address=|{{#if:{{{name|}}}<!--
-->|{{#ifeq:{{{unesco}}}|yes|{{ЮНЕСКО}}&thinsp;|}}<!--
-->{{#ifeq:{{{star}}}|yes|&nbsp;<span title="Важная достопримечательность">&#9734;</span>&thinsp;|}}<!--
--><span style="margin-left:0.4em; font-weight:bold">{{#if:{{{url|}}}|[{{{url|}}} '''<span class="listing-name">{{{name}}}</span>''']|'''<span class="listing-name">{{{name}}}</span>'''|}}}}</span><!--
-->{{#if:{{{alt|}}}|&#32;(''<span class="listing-alt">{{{alt}}}</span>'')|}}<!--
-->{{#if:{{{address|}}}||{{#if:{{{directions|}}}||.}}}}}}</span><!--
 
URL, facebook, vkontakte
-->{{#switch: {{{format|}}}|poi=|address=|{{#if:{{{wdid|}}}|&thinsp;[[File:Wikidata-logo.svg|20px|link=http://www.wikidata.org/wiki/{{{wdid}}}|Элемент в Викиданных]]|}}{{#if:{{{facebook|}}}|<span class="noprint">&thinsp;[[File:Facebook icon.svg|16x16px14x14px|link={{{facebook|}}}]]&thinsp;</span>|}}{{#if:{{{vkontakte|}}}|{{#if:{{{facebook|}}}||&thinsp;}}<span class="noprint">[[File:V Kontakte Russian V.png|16x16px14x14px|link={{{vkontakte|}}}]]&thinsp;</span>|}}}}<!--
 
Address
-->{{#switch: {{{format|}}}|poi=|address=&thinsp;{{{address|}}}{{#if:{{{directions|}}}|&#32;({{#ifeq:<span {{#invokestyle="font-style:String|find|italic">{{{directions}}}|thinsp}} | 0 |''{{{directions}}}''|{{{directions}}}}}</span>). |. }}|<!--
-->{{#if:{{{address|}}}|, <span class="label">{{{address|}}}</span>{{#if:{{{directions|}}}|&#32;(<span style="font-style:italic">{{{directions|}}}</span>). |. }}|{{#if:{{{directions|}}}|, (<span style="font-style:italic">{{{directions|}}}</span>). |}}}}}}<!--
 
E-mail and Phone
Строка 52 ⟶ 50 :
 
Metadata - last edit date, "edit" link, etc
 
-->{{#ifeq:{{{format|}}}|poi||<span class="listing-metadata">{{#if:{{{lastedit|}}}
|&nbsp;<!--